10 Kelsey Eden Way, Cumberland, RI 02864North Cumberland is a rural neighborhood characterized by homes spread along winding backroads and dense forests. Residences vary from late 20th-century ranch-style and split-level homes to classic Colonial Revivals and Cape Cods, with newer constructions featuring Colonial or farmhouse-inspired designs. The area is known for its spacious lots, ranging from one to three acres, and the Hidden Meadow development is set to introduce additional luxury properties. North Cumberland encircles the Diamond Hill Reservoir, adjacent to Diamond Hill Park, which offers hiking trails and hosts events like CumberlandFest and 13th World. The nearby Wentworth Hills Country Club provides an 18-hole golf course and pickleball courts. Adam’s Farm, a major autumn attraction with a corn maze and hayrides, is a local highlight. While the neighborhood has few businesses, residents typically travel into town for shopping, with Dave’s Fresh Marketplace located south of Cumberland and Ravenous Brewing Company being a popular pitstop. Major shopping centers like Wrentham Village Premium Outlets and Emerald Square Mall are within a short drive. North Cumberland is within 15 to 20 miles of Providence and 40 to 50 miles of Boston, with nearby highways and commuter rail options. The neighborhood is served by highly rated schools, including Community Elementary, North Cumberland Middle, and Cumberland High.
On average, homes in North Cumberland, Cumberland sell after 15 days on the market compared to the national average of 47 days. The average sale price for homes in North Cumberland, Cumberland over the last 12 months is $974,064, up 4% from the average home sale price over the previous 12 months.
